A foreclosure defense attorney helps homeowners fight to keep their property when lenders initiate legal action. They review your loan documents for errors, identify potential violations of lending laws, and negotiate alternatives like loan modifications or short sales. If you have received a notice of default, you should speak with an attorney to understand your rights and the timeline for a response. A defense lawyer's role in Pembroke Pines is to protect your constitutional rights and build the strongest possible defense against criminal charges. They investigate the facts, challenge the prosecution's evidence, negotiate plea bargains, and represent you in court. Their primary objective is to achieve the best possible outcome for their client, whether that means acquittal, reduced charges, or a lighter sentence.
